Ian A. Makey, M.D., is a cardiothoracic surgeon and transplant surgeon with the Lung Transplant Program within the Transplant Center and chair of the Department of Cardiothoracic Surgery at Mayo Clinic in Jacksonville, FL. His clinical interestes include making lung cancer surgery as effective and pain-free as possible, preserving the lungs with techniques such as sublobar or sleeve resections in appropriate situations, treating end-stage lung disease with lung volume reduction surgery (LVRS) or lung transplantation, improving symptoms of myasthenia gravis with robotic thymectomy, using minimally invasive surgery for benign and malignant esophageal diseases, and inventing medical devices such as "smart" chest tubes to treat pleural space problems.
